I'm having a bit of difficulty getting file sharing control to work correctly with shares I set up.

There's a share called "Books" (/var/hda/files/books) where I have restricted access to just 1 of my users through the HDA interface. However, this doesn't seem to work. Am I missing something?

Hi Mike,

Did you update fedora by hand recently? If so, you may experience this issue.

You can tell you have the issue linked above if the file /var/lib/samba/private/smbpasswd (in your HDA) has only one user called guest.

If not, make sure the share is visible and accessible to that user in the share settings for Books.
